Los Angeles Collegiate Playwrights Festival
The Los Angeles Collegiate Playwrights Festival celebrates the launch of their inaugural year of bringing college playwrights together with industry professionals to provide a stepping stone for up-and-coming writers.
LACPFest presents six original one-act plays -
Ghost Girl by Covi Loveridge Brannan -The New School 2019 - Directed by James Elden Zap by Sean Dunnington - University of Redlands 2019 - Directed by Shaun Landry Adoption by Gillian Gurney Boston University 2021 and Jesse Nadel - Yale University 2021 - Directed by Gwen Hillier American Pie by Rebecca Katz - USC 2019 - Directed by James Elden Bud, Wiser by Michael Narkunski - Stony Brook University 2018 - Directed by Dean Bruggeman Harry the Hippo by Megan Rivkin - Tufts University 2020 - Directed by Dan Fishbach
